Transaction 26bfb80e591a6ed61dbf03d8af73f42245009e37e896dee5e856998655704263

18 Input
2 Outputs
  • 26bfb80e591a6ed61dbf03d8af73f42245009e37e896dee5e856998655704263:0
  • value  349982000
    address  1B2mVBdnTGiGVCvs3T2qYNDKdMmMAUmbMP
  • 26bfb80e591a6ed61dbf03d8af73f42245009e37e896dee5e856998655704263:1
  • value  1000020
    address  1KgMMWZ96ctoVYNLTFeagdLPaB81KRd98B